Winchester Bancorp, Inc. Announces Results for the Year Ended June 30, 2026

businesswire.com

Winchester Bancorp, Inc. Announces Results for the Year Ended June 30, 2026 WINCHESTER, Mass.--( BUSINESS WIRE)--Winchester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-WSBK) (the "Company"), the holding company for Winchester Savings Bank (the "Bank"), today announced its fiscal 2026 financial results. The Company reported net income of $4.4 million, or $0.49 per common share, as compared to net loss of $874,000 for the year ended June 30, 2025, an increase of $5.3 million in net income. Operating net income for the year ended June 30, 2025, which excludes our contribution to the Winchester Savings Bank Charitable Foundation, Inc. (the "Charitable Foundation"), was $750,000 (non-GAAP), making the year over year increase $3.7 million on an adjusted basis.

“In our first full year as a public company, we've demonstrated the ability to deploy capital prudently to grow the franchise. Loan and deposit growth were both impressive year-over-year, up $119.6 million, or 15.9% and $130.1 million, or 19.1%, respectively. Total assets grew more than $146.5 million, or 15.4%, while profitability also improved, with margin expanding to 2.55% from 2.05% and efficiency improving to 75.2% from 85.5% (non-GAAP), both compared to June 30, 2025," said John A. Carroll, President and Chief Executive Officer. "Our first year as a public company was a strong one, from establishing our municipal department to delivering double digit growth and improved earnings. We look forward to building on that momentum as we enter our second year of creating shareholder value,” Carroll added.

BALANCE SHEET

Total assets were $1.10 billion at June 30, 2026, representing an increase of $146.6 million, or 15.4%, from June 30, 2025.

NET INTEREST INCOME

Net interest income was $25.0 million for the year ended June 30, 2026, compared to $17.5 million for the year ended June 30, 2025, representing an increase of $7.5 million, or 42.6%. Net interest margin expanded by 50 basis points to 2.55% for the year ended June 30, 2026 compared to 2.05% for the year ended June 30, 2025.

NON-INTEREST INCOME

Non-interest income was $1.3 million for the year ended June 30, 2026, compared to $1.8 million for the year ended June 30, 2025. Non-interest income for the year ended June 30, 2025 includes a one-time gain on the sale of equity securities.

NON-INTEREST EXPENSE

Non-interest expense was $19.8 million for the year ended June 30, 2026, representing an increase of $1.0 million, or 5.2%, from the year ended June 30, 2025 due to increases in salaries and employee benefits, marketing and data processing expense offset by a decrease in other general and administrative expenses as the prior year included a $2.3 million charitable foundation contribution.

ASSET QUALITY

Asset quality remains strong. The allowance for credit losses on loans in total and as a percentage of total gross loans as of June 30, 2026 was $4.8 million and 0.55%, compared to $4.2 million and 0.55% as of June 30, 2025.

(1) Net interest rate spread represents the difference between the weighted average yield on interest-earning assets and the weighted average rate of interest-bearing liabilities.

(2) Net interest-earning assets represent total interest-earning assets less total interest-bearing liabilities.

(3) Net interest margin represents net interest income divided by average total interest-earning assets.
